About the Role

The Lead Consultant Psychiatrist is accountable for the delivery of high-quality clinical services to the consumers of SVMH Community Acute Response Team (CART). This role provides clinical leadership in partnership with the Team Manager, and under the direction of the Clinical Director Acute Psychiatry, Director Adult Mental Health and the relevant Group Operations Manager. The Consultant Psychiatrist will clinically lead the CART Service, providing demonstrated excellence in clinical leadership and service development

The CART Services are Psychiatric Triage, Extended Triage, Emergency Department Mental Health (EDMH), Emergency Department Mental Health & Alcohol & Other Drug Hub (ED MH&AOD Hub), Crisis Assessment and Treatment Team (CATT), Police Ambulance Clinical Early Response (PACER) and Medical Safe Injecting Room (MSIR).

Classifications for this position will range from Specialist Year 5 HN39 to Specialist Year 9 HN59 ($193.67 - $221.19 per hour). Classification dependent on years of experience.

About St Vincent's Mental Health & Wellbeing
St. Vincent’s Mental Health & Wellbeing (SVMHW) includes an adult area mental health & wellbeing service for the inner-city areas of Yarra and Boroondara.  It includes a range of inpatient, residential and community based programs, providing treatment to older youth (18-25yo), adults and older adults who experience acute and complex mental health issues. Multidisciplinary teams provide a range of clinical and therapeutic interventions underpinned by a strong commitment to recovery focused practice and person-centred care.

Working at St Vincent’s
St Vincent’s Hospital Melbourne (SVHM) is a leading teaching, research and tertiary health service. SVHM provides a diverse range of adult clinical services and is driven by values of Compassion, Justice, Integrity and Excellence.
